Summary
If you make 442,520 lei a year living in Romania, you will be taxed 183,646 lei. That means that your net pay will be 258,874 lei per year, or 21,573 lei per month. Your average tax rate is 41.5% and your marginal tax rate is 41.5%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 lei in your salary will be taxed 41.50 lei, hence, your net pay will only increase by 58.50 lei.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 lei bonus will generate an extra 585 lei of net incomes. A 5,000 lei bonus will generate an extra 2,925 lei of net incomes.
